Bery Carter, DeWitt County, Texas, 1867

Bery Carter registered to vote in DeWitt County on July 30, 1867. He reported 16 years in Texas, 14 of them in DeWitt County. DeWitt County registered 364 freedmen in 1867, 35% of its voters.
